Simple Apple Cake

This Simple Apple Cake is a moist, tender dessert made from scratch with juicy chunks of fresh apples and warm spices like cinnamon and nutmeg. Easy to make without a mixer, it’s perfect for breakfast, brunch, dessert, or a quick sweet treat any time of the year.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 2 tsp baking powder
  • ½ tsp baking soda
  • ½ cup unsalted butter, melted (or vegetable oil)
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 2 large eggs
  • ¾ cup Greek yogurt (or sour cream, buttermilk, or kefir)
  • 3 cups fresh apples, peeled, cored, and cut into chunks
  • ¼ cup brown sugar (for tossing apples)
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 tsp ground cinnamon
  • ¼ tsp ground nutmeg
  • Optional toppings: confectioners’ sugar, caramel sauce, vanilla ice cream

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ease a 9×3-inch springform pan or a high-sided 9-inch round cake pan.
  2. Toss apple chunks with brown sugar, cinnamon, and nutmeg; set aside.
  3. In a large bowl, whisk together flour, baking powder, and baking soda.
  4. In another bowl, whisk melted butter, sugar, eggs, Greek yogurt, and vanilla until smooth.
  5. Fold dry ingredients into wet ingredients until just combined; do not overmix.
  6. Gently fold in the apple mixture.
  7. Pour batter into prepared pan, spreading evenly.
  8. Bake for 45–55 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
  9. Cool slightly before serving warm, or cool completely before dusting with powdered sugar or adding toppings.

Notes

  • Use a mix of sweet and tart apples for more flavor depth.
  • Add chopped walnuts, pecans, or almonds for crunch.
  • Swap some butter for melted coconut oil for a unique flavor twist.
  • Add cloves or allspice for a deeper spice profile.
  • Serve warm with caramel sauce and ice cream for a decadent dessert.
